How they compare
Serbia currently reports 1.63 terawatt-hours against 1.61 terawatt-hours in Lebanon, a difference of 0.02 terawatt-hours.
The two have swapped places 3 times across 13 shared years of data; in 2012 it was Serbia ahead.
Lebanon ranks 72nd and Serbia ranks 71st of 208 countries.
Serbia has averaged higher in every one of the 2 decades both report.
